Aug 22, 2021The game is full of guesswork and trying to do things you know you have to but can't figure out the convoluted way to actually do. The story is fine for the first half or so, but then it becomes a mess of information you're supposed to piece together into something coherent. Repeating the same thing over and over numbed my mind and I would stop after an hour if I was playing alone.

Sep 20, 2021Good concept, terrible execution. The game quickly becomes tedious and boring, forcing you to replay loops in search of what it expects from you. You often know what you *want* to do, the real challenge being how to explain the game you want to do it. Give it a try if you're subscribed to the Gamepass, but don't spend your money on it otherwise.

Game World Navigator MagazineNov 30, 2021It’s one of those cases where it’s really hard to rate a game. It has a great concept and good plot delivery, but actual gameplay is incredibly frustrating. You’re stuck in the loop along with your character, with no way to fast-forward the events, and you have to meticulously try every possible combination, until find the trigger that will open up a new option. And then you re-check it all over again. [Issue#256, p.44]
